Chapter 1. Introduction to DevSecOps
We did not start our careers in security, but we both know that delivering software is of utmost importance to developers. “Delivering software” in this context means delivering something that does what it is supposed to do. This could refer to the code being stable, or the software meeting the functional requirements (for example, a calculator can add, multiply, subtract, and divide numbers) and performance expectations without any issues (for example, a chat application allows more than 10 people to send messages to each other simultaneously).
Building quality software, however, requires good coding practices, resilient architectures, and security. It’s common for security to be added into the software after it has been built, but the shift-left approach recommends moving security to much earlier in the development life cycle, building it in from the start. We will discuss that approach in this chapter, focusing on Security as Code (SaC). In this approach, our infrastructure’s security policies—detection, prevention, remediation—are all defined as code.
